Hello and welcome to WeRelate. Thank you for submitting your gedcom file. There are a few problems I would like you to look at. WeRelate creates a wiki page for each Person and for each Family in the file. The Family pages are used to show relationships between spouses and between parents and children. You have a number of living people in your file. We must exclude these for privacy reasons. There are people who appear to be living and for whom you show address information. This would be a problem if these pages were created. Please review your file checking carefully that the exclude box is checked for any living people. Also, please review the Family page. In many cases, the family will have only one person and a family page is not needed. These should also be excluded. It would be a good idea to review the pages mentioned on the warning tab. You can perhaps correct these problems before the file is imported. When you are done, please return to the Import tab and mark the file ready for import.
